twas fridays evening herald.and i quote:
former arsenal player brian mcgovern is still in limbo after a move to newry city fell through.
defender mcgovern (24) has not played for longford town in five months and did'nt even make the squad for their fai cup final win over waterford utd.
he was heavily critisised by manager alan matthews and then dropped after a
2-1 defeat in july and mcgovern made just one more appearance for the midlanders.
a move to spl side inverness collapsed when longford demanded a fee and this week a planned move across the border to newry also failed to materialise.
"i d'ont know whats going to happen" says mcgovern who made one premiership appearance under arsene wenger in his four seasons at arsenal.
"longford have said i'm part of their plans for next season-i have a year left on my contract-but they have'nt played me since the summer and i was'nt involved for the cup final,so its a confusing situation".
shamrock rovers have also expressed an interest in mcgovern who played for arsenal,qpr,norwich and peterborough before coming home to irelans in 2003,joining town after a brief spell with st pats.
